How Wagering Works

Wagering requirements are the number of times you must bet through a b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, if you receive a $100 bonus with a 20x wagering requirement, you must place bets totaling $2,000 (100 x 20) before cashing out. Let’s calculate that: $100 * 20 = $2,000. If the game you play contributes only 50% to wagering (e.g., some table games), you’d need to bet $4,000: $2,000 / 0.5 = $4,000. Always check the contribution percentages as slots usually count 100%, while blackjack may count 10% or less.

Extra Tips

For better odds, focus on games with higher RTP (Return to Player) percentages. Video slots often have RTPs above 96%, while some table games like blackjack can be up to 99.5%. Avoid games like keno or certain progressive slots with low RTP. Always check the game’s RTP in the info section before playing.
